1.3.1 IP addresses
An IP address is a number assigned to your computer when you connect to the internet. It allows computers and servers to recognize each other and share data. When you visit our website, your IP address is recorded and used for system diagnostic and security purposes. The IP address is also used in compiling indicators that determine the traffic and usefulness of the website.

1.3.3 Web beacons
A web beacon is a small image file on a website that may be used to collect information about a visitor’s computer, including the IP address, time of visit, browser type and previously stored cookies from the same server. When using web beacons we strictly follow the requirements of legal acts.
We or our service providers will use web beacons to ensure the proper management of cookies and to determine the usefulness of services provided by third parties to us — for example, visitors attracted by information distribution, advertising or recruitment services.
You can limit the functionality of web beacons by disallowing the storage of cookies needed for their operation. In that case, the web beacon may still record an anonymous visit from a specific IP address, but cookie information will not be stored.
In some of our newsletters or other communications we monitor recipient actions, e.g. opening of an e-mail, using web beacons. We use the collected information to determine user interest and to increase user satisfaction in the future.
